Can You Give A Dog Cooked Fish. It’s not recommended to feed your dog raw or undercooked fish, since raw fish is at risk of carrying harmful bacteria like salmonella and listeria. Don’t make cooked fish a daily part of your dog’s diet—to avoid too much exposure to the mercury fish can contain. Be sure to remove any bones. In general, dogs can tolerate a small amount of plain, cooked fish in their diet. If you’re looking for different foods to mix up your canine’s diet, you’ll be pleased to learn dogs can eat fish.
